Output 80c3afb90510d6b3c3c235cae681191dafbbe1fafd10e8962f7b096940145b00:0

value
6963471242574
script pubkey
OP_0 OP_PUSHBYTES_20 10dc8789a807a9e7fb8a8c2fa7607133a77de175
address
tb1qzrwg0zdgq75707u23sh6wcr3xwnhmct4thjhnv
transaction
80c3afb90510d6b3c3c235cae681191dafbbe1fafd10e8962f7b096940145b00
confirmations
154159
spent
true